Speech has quietly emerged as one of the quickest methods for writing: most individuals speak roughly three times
faster than they can type. However, the leading Mac dictation tools now demand $10–$15 every month and send
recordings through their own remote servers. ShoutFlow was designed on a completely different philosophy. It is a
single upfront purchase, and by default it handles audio processing on the Mac itself, employing speech models that operate
locally on Apple Silicon — meaning in local mode, a user’s voice never exits their machine.
ShoutFlow is located in the menu bar. Users activate a hotkey, start speaking, and see a live preview of their
words appear in a small recording overlay that fits neatly around the MacBook notch or can be positioned
anywhere on the display. When they finish, ShoutFlow processes the audio, removes filler words, adjusts
punctuation and formatting, and places the completed text directly at the cursor — within Mail, Slack,
Safari, a code editor, or any other program.

Main features at launch:
– Operates across the entire system: dictate into any macOS application, with text automatically placed at the cursor
and a clipboard fallback option.
– Local processing as standard: transcription and text refinement run on Apple Silicon hardware; in local
mode, no audio gets transmitted anywhere.
– Real-time preview: observe words appearing as you talk, inside an overlay crafted for the MacBook notch.
– Customization: a personal dictionary for names and specialized terms, reusable text snippets, and per-app tones
so a Slack message differs in style from a formal email.
– Dictation log: every recording is stored locally and can be retrieved and copied later.
– Optional bring-your-own-key cloud mode: users who favor cloud-based models can link their own
OpenAI, Google Gemini, OpenRouter, DeepSeek, Kimi, or xAI account. Keys are stored in the macOS
Keychain and audio travels directly from the Mac to the chosen provider — never passing through ShoutFlow’s
servers.
ShoutFlow is available for $25 as a one-time purchase, and a single license covers two Macs. No
subscription or account is needed to test it: a seven-day free trial begins with a single click and
does not request any credit card details. The application is a signed, notarized direct download from
https://shoutflow.ai and requires macOS 14 or later on an Apple Silicon Mac (M1 or newer).
